HBAR Technical Analysis Breakdown
Hedera’s technical landscape presents a sophisticated picture for traders and investors analyzing potential price movements.
RSI analysis: The 14-period RSI is 44.94, which puts HBAR firmly in neutral territory. This does not suggest either overbought or oversold, indicating the potential for a move in either direction based on market catalysts.
MACD Signals: The MACD line at -0.0016 corresponds to the signal line, giving a histogram reading of 0.0000. This flat histogram indicates that bear momentum has stalled, potentially preparing for a directional breakout.
Moving Average Context: HBAR is trading near its short-term moving averages (SMAs 7, 20, and 50, all at $0.09), but remains well below the 200 SMA at $0.13. This suggests that despite recent consolidation, the long-term trend remains down.
Bollinger Bands: With a %B position of 0.42, HBAR is trading in the lower half of the Bollinger Band range, indicating the potential for an upside move towards the mid-band if buying pressure emerges.
Hedera Price Targets: A Bull vs. Bear Case
Bullish scenario
In a bullish outcome, HBAR price prediction models suggest initial resistance at the psychological level of $0.10. A break above this threshold could push towards the $0.105-$0.11 range, which would represent a 15-20% upside from current levels.
Key technical confirmation would include: – RSI breaking above 50 with sustained momentum – MACD histogram turning positive – Increased volume on any upside moves – Reflection of the middle Bollinger Band as support
A bearish scenario
As bearish pressure intensifies, Hedera’s forecast models point to initial support at $0.088, closely related to current powerful support levels. A break below could expose the psychological level of $0.08, representing a potential decline of 8-10%.
Risk factors include: – Broader cryptocurrency market weakness – Regulatory uncertainty impacting enterprise adoption of blockchain – Competition from other enterprise-focused blockchain platforms – Macroeconomic headwinds impacting risky assets
